Expression and Localization of Fibroblast Growth Factor 10 (FGF10) in Ovarian Follicle During Different Stages Development in Buffalo
S.R. Mishra, Jaya Bharati, M.K. Bharti, G. Singh and M. Sarkar

Abstract: Fibroblast Growth Factor (FGF) family is considered as local cytokines produced from many physiological systems including ovary. The FGFs regulate many cellular processes like angiogenesis, cell proliferation, cell survival, organogenesis and embryonic development including ovarian folliculogenesis. Fibroblast Growth Factor 10 (FGF10) is one of most important member in FGF family which mostly mediates epithelial cell motility, differentiation, migration and wound healing in many cellular system. The FGF10 is also known to regulate the ovarian follicular dynamics in an autocrine and paracrine manner. Therefore, the present study was undertaken aimed with an objective to evaluate the expression and localization of FGF10 in different follicular size or groups during various stages of follicular development in buffalo ovary. The mRNA and protein expression of FGF10 transcripts did not differ significantly in all follicular size during follicular development. The FGF10 was exclusively localized in Granulosa Cell (GC) and Theca Interna (TI) showing a stage specific immunoreactivity throughout the follicular developmental process in buffalo ovary. The present findings suggest the species specific expression and localization pattern of FGF10 in buffalo ovarian follicle.
